Proxies are intermediaries that allow users to route their internet requests through a different server, masking the original IP address. For businesses engaged in e-commerce, proxies are invaluable for several reasons. They help bypass geographical restrictions, reduce the risk of IP blocking, and enable market intelligence activities like price scraping and competitor analysis.
The primary concern for e-commerce businesses is the increasing sophistication of anti-bot systems implemented by platforms. These systems detect patterns such as high request frequencies, repeated IP access, and other abnormal behaviors that are often associated with bots. This is where proxies come in. By using proxies, businesses can simulate human-like browsing behavior, making it harder for anti-bot systems to detect them.
There are two main types of proxies used in e-commerce applications: data center proxies and residential proxies.
- Data Center Proxies are typically faster and more cost-effective, but they are often associated with suspicious activity due to the fact that many other users may be utilizing the same IP addresses.
- Residential Proxies, on the other hand, are IP addresses provided by internet service providers (ISPs) to homeowners. These proxies are much harder to detect because they are associated with real users.
When a platform detects traffic from residential IP addresses, it is less likely to flag the request as coming from a bot. This is because residential proxies are linked to actual, physical locations and are therefore considered more trustworthy.

While residential proxies are powerful tools, they are not without their challenges and limitations:
1. Higher Cost
Residential proxies tend to be more expensive than data center proxies. This is due to the fact that they are more difficult to acquire and maintain. Businesses must weigh the benefits of using residential proxies against the additional cost to determine whether they are a cost-effective solution.
2. Reliability of Proxy Providers
The reliability of residential proxies depends heavily on the provider. While PyProxy offers a reliable service, not all proxy providers offer the same quality. Businesses must ensure that they choose a reputable provider to avoid interruptions in service or connection issues.
3. Slower Speeds Compared to Data Center Proxies
While residential proxies are more difficult to detect, they can sometimes be slower than data center proxies. This can be a concern for businesses that need to scrape large amounts of data quickly. However, with tools like PyProxy, these issues can be minimized.
